The Effectiveness of Perioperative Intravenous Lidocaine on Opioid Consumption and Postoperative Pain in Total Abdominal Hysterectomy

The Effectiveness of Perioperative Intravenous Lidocaine on Opioid Consumption and Postoperative Pain in Total Abdominal Hysterectomy: A Double-blinded Randomized Controlled Trial.

Interventions

Lidocaine 1.5 mg/kg upto 10 ml bolus then Lidocaine 2 mg/kg/hr. upto 20 ml Infusion volume rate 20 ml/hr. in surgery and 1 hr after surgery ,same volume of NSS
Experimental Drug,Placebo Comparator No treatment
Lidocaine,saline

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Female patients Aged 30&#45;65 years BMI < 35 kg/m2 American Society of Anesthesiologists (ASA) physical status I or II Scheduled for elective abdominal hysterectomy with general anesthesia.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Unable to use IV&#45;PCA History of allergy to local anesthetics Severe cardiovascular&#44; respiratory&#44; renal or hepatic disease History of seizure Severe psychiatric medical history Preoperative opioids medication and substance abuse Chronic pain syndromes
